Materials Data on TlNO2 by Materials Project
TlNO2 crystallizes in the triclinic P1 space group. The structure is three-dimensional. Tl1+ is bonded in a 7-coordinate geometry to five O2- atoms. There are a spread of Tl–O bond distances ranging from 2.95–3.23 Å. N3+ is bonded in a bent 120 degrees geometry to two O2- atoms. Both N–O bond lengths are 1.27 Å. There are two inequivalent O2- sites. In the first O2- site, O2- is bonded in a distorted single-bond geometry to three equivalent Tl1+ and one N3+ atom. In the second O2- site, O2- is bonded in a distorted single-bond geometry to two equivalent Tl1+ and one N3+ atom.
